What is Home Insulation?

Home insulation refers to the materials and methods used to reduce heat transfer between the inside and outside of a building. Insulation can be found in various forms, including:

  • Fiberglass batts
  • Foam board insulation
  • Spray foam insulation
  • Cellulose insulation
  • Mineral wool

Why is Home Insulation Important?

The importance of home insulation cannot be overstated. Here are some key reasons why it is essential for homeowners:

  • Improved Energy Efficiency: Proper insulation helps maintain a consistent indoor temperature, reducing the need for heating and cooling systems.
  • Lower Energy Bills: A well-insulated home can significantly lower energy costs by minimizing heat loss during winter and heat gain during summer.
  • Increased Comfort: Insulation provides a more comfortable living environment by preventing drafts and cold spots.
  • Noise Reduction: Insulation can also help reduce noise pollution from outside, creating a quieter home.
  • Environmental Impact: By reducing energy consumption, well-insulated homes contribute to lower carbon emissions.

Types of Insulation and Their Benefits

Fiberglass Insulation

Fiberglass insulation is one of the most common types used in homes. It is affordable, fire-resistant, and provides excellent thermal performance.

Foam Board Insulation

Foam board insulation offers high insulating value for relatively little thickness. It’s ideal for foundation walls, basement walls, and exterior walls.

Spray Foam Insulation

Spray foam insulation expands on application, filling gaps and cracks. It creates a strong air barrier and provides excellent insulation.

Cellulose Insulation

Made from recycled paper products, cellulose insulation is an eco-friendly option. It is treated with fire retardants and is effective in reducing air leaks.

Mineral Wool Insulation

Mineral wool insulation is made from natural or synthetic fibers. It is resistant to fire, water, and pests, making it a durable choice for many homeowners.

How to Assess Your Home's Insulation Needs

To determine whether your home needs insulation or additional insulation, consider the following steps:

  • Conduct a visual inspection of your attic, basement, and crawl spaces.
  • Check for drafts around windows and doors.
  • Monitor your energy bills for any sudden increases.
  • Consider a professional energy audit to identify areas of improvement.
